Sdílet prostřednictvím


SqlNotificationRequest Třída

Definice

Představuje požadavek na oznámení pro daný příkaz.

public ref class SqlNotificationRequest sealed
public sealed class SqlNotificationRequest
type SqlNotificationRequest = class
Public NotInheritable Class SqlNotificationRequest
Dědičnost
SqlNotificationRequest

Poznámky

Tato třída poskytuje nízkoúrovňový přístup ke službám oznámení dotazů vystaveným SQL Server 2005. Pro většinu aplikací SqlDependency třída poskytuje jednodušší způsob používání oznámení dotazů. Pokud ale potřebujete mít plnou kontrolu nad tím, kdy k oznámením dochází, nebo potřebujete přizpůsobit data zpráv vrácená jako součást oznámení, SqlNotificationRequest použije se třída.

Konstruktory

SqlNotificationRequest()

Vytvoří novou instanci třídy s výchozími SqlNotificationRequest hodnotami.

SqlNotificationRequest(String, String, Int32)

Vytvoří novou instanci SqlNotificationRequest třídy s uživatelem definovaným řetězcem, který identifikuje konkrétní žádost o oznámení, název předdefinované SQL Server název služby Service Broker 2005 a časový limit měřený v sekundách.

Vlastnosti

Options

Získá nebo nastaví název služby SQL Server Service Broker, kde jsou publikovány zprávy oznámení.

Timeout

Získá nebo nastaví hodnotu, která určuje, jak dlouho SQL Server čeká na změnu před vypršením časového limitu operace.

UserData

Získá nebo nastaví identifikátor specifické pro aplikaci pro toto oznámení.

Platí pro

Viz také